1. Define Your Decision Points

Goal: Identify the specific decisions you want to automate or augment.

  • Map Routine Tasks: List tasks susceptible to automation, like scheduling, prioritizing emails, or choosing apps.
  • Survey Users: Understand common patterns and bottlenecks in users' decision-making processes.
  • Clear Objectives: Define what success looks like for your tool—whether it's more time saved or reduced user stress.

2. Prioritize Seamless UI/UX Design

Goal: Create an interface that feels natural and intuitive.

  • Wireframe Early: Sketch interfaces focusing on simplicity and clarity.
  • Prototyping Tools: Use tools like Figma or Sketch to visualize flow.
  • Test with Real Users: Collect feedback to refine interactions, keeping them sticky but unobtrusive.

3. Leverage AI for Customization

Goal: Use AI to tailor experiences and offer smart insights.

  • Data-Driven Insights: Implement machine learning models that learn from user data to provide recommendations.
  • AI Models: Use TensorFlow or PyTorch for robust backend support.
  • Continuous Learning: Ensure models evolve with new data inputs, personalizing experiences.

4. Build a Robust Tech Stack

Goal: Use modern, flexible technologies for rapid iteration.

  • Backend Frameworks: Consider Django or Flask for Python lovers, or Node.js for JavaScript enthusiasts.
  • Frontend Tools: Utilize React or Vue.js for dynamic UIs.
  • Database Management: Use Firebase or MongoDB for real-time, scalable data storage.

5. Integrate Contextual Intelligence

Goal: Make decisions smarter with context awareness.

  • Context Gathering: Capture and analyze context like time, location, past behaviors.
  • Predictive Modeling: Use AI to predict user needs before they arise, such as reminding users of tasks based on their routine.

6. Emphasize Context Management and Component Reuse

Goal: Maintain clarity and efficiency in code management.

  • Modularize Code: Write reusable components to streamline updates and maintenance.
  • State Management: Use Redux or Context API for state handling across complex applications.

7. Address Common Pitfalls

Goal: Avoid mistakes that hinder usability and performance.

  • Overcomplication: Avoid bogging down users with too many options or settings.
  • Data Privacy: Clearly communicate data usage policies and maintain user trust.
  • Performance Checks: Regularly test and optimize for speed and responsiveness.
